How about taking a Florida vacation to Northern Florida? More specifically, the northwest section of the state, where beautiful little cities with sandy beaches on the Gulf of Mexico create a relaxing, invigorating, environment.

Located near Panama City Beach, the WaterColor region is where the movie "The Truman Show" was shot. And much like the film, you'll find yourself wondering if it's real or all just a movie set.

It's perfection, as is the golf.

The Camp Creek Golf Club is a world-class course, designed by the legendary Tom Fazio.

This course was ranked eight last year out of the seven hundred public-access courses.

The course was recently selected as one of the Top Golf Courses in the United States by the Zagat Guides for 2007-08.

The 7,151-yard course is vastly governed by water, which should come as no surprise given its proximity to the Gulf.
The northwest Florida area is a great golfing destination.
